Tragic Stand: Man's Sacrifice Highlights Banjara Reservation Struggle
In Maharashtra's Beed district, a man named Pravin Baburao Jadhav has allegedly committed suicide over the Banjara community's demand for Scheduled Tribes reservation. His video statement highlighted frustration with the government's decisions favoring other communities. Locals protested, urging government intervention on this pressing issue.

A tragic incident unfolded in Maharashtra's Beed district as a 32-year-old man reportedly took his own life due to frustration over the Banjara community's reservation demands.
The deceased, identified as Pravin Baburao Jadhav, shared a heartfelt video on social media before hanging himself from a tree in Kekat Pangri village. He expressed his discontent with the government’s decision to grant certain privileges to other communities, leaving the Banjaras behind.
Following the tragic event, local residents staged a protest, blocking the Dhule-Solapur road and demanding swift government action. Authorities registered a case of accidental death and are conducting further investigations.
